The secretary of justice (Filipino: kalihim ng katarungan) is the head of the Department of Justice and is a member of the president's Cabinet. [ 1 ] The current secretary is Jesus Crispin Remulla , who assumed office on June 30, 2022.
Jesus Crispin "Boying" Catibayan Remulla (Tagalog pronunciation: [rɛˈmuljɐ]; born March 31, 1961) [citation needed] is a Filipino lawyer and politician serving as the Secretary of Justice since 2022 in the Cabinet of President Bongbong Marcos.

The department is led by the Secretary of Justice, nominated by the president of the Philippines and confirmed by the Commission on Appointments. The secretary is a member of the Cabinet. President Bongbong Marcos named Jesus Crispin Remulla as secretary of Justice on May 23, 2022. [3]

Rodrigo Duterte assumed office as President of the Philippines on June 30, 2016, and his term ended on June 30, 2022. On May 31, 2016, a few weeks before his presidential inauguration, Duterte named his Cabinet members, [8] which comprised a diverse selection of former military generals, childhood friends, classmates, and leftists.
